#56cde3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#56cde3 is composed of 33.7% red, 80.4%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.1% cyan, 9.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 189.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 61.4%. #56cde3 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#009bc7.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#56cde3 color description : Soft cyan.
The hexadecimal color #56cde3 has RGB values of R:86, G:205,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5688803.
